WebMar 14, 2024 · A Brief History of Czech Republic By Tim Lambert THE FIRST CZECHS From about 400 BC what is now the Czech Republic was inhabited by a Celtic race. The Romans called them the Boii and they gave their name to Bohemia. Then about 100 AD a Germanic people called the Marcomanni conquered the area.

WebMay 1, 2004 · Czechia is a parliamentary republic with a head of government - the prime minister - and a head of state - the president. The country was formed in 1993, after Czechoslovakia was split into Czechia and Slovakia. The country is now divided into 14 regions, including the capital, Prague. WebThe Czech Republic ( Czech: Česká republika, pronounced [ˈtʃɛskaː ˈrɛpuˌblɪka] ( listen)) is a country in Central Europe. As of 2 May 2016, the official short name of the country is Czechia ( Czech: Česko ). The capital and the biggest city is Prague. The currency is the Czech Crown ( koruna česká - CZK). €1 is about 25 CZK.
